Canadian Auto Repairs Ltd

Comments on Canadian Auto Repairs Ltd. 3850 19 st ne #6, Calgary T2E6V2 AB
Please share as much information as you can about Canadian Auto Repairs Ltd so other users can benefit from your comment.
Can't read?